Output 1abb7143cd0b393fe9b7a1373858673da82d4ac4efdbbf2bc00a5334edf0a9fc:0

value
1002964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ad3033a5f745be58876ac622b577eeb726e00029 OP_EQUAL
address
3HUkZr4u5NW2Eg42kPA1NmcMQBLezKSyfw
transaction
1abb7143cd0b393fe9b7a1373858673da82d4ac4efdbbf2bc00a5334edf0a9fc
confirmations
114794
spent
true